Whistly is a location-based community signal platform operated by SoftSignal Canada. We are deeply committed to protecting children from sexual abuse and exploitation online. Any content that sexually exploits or endangers minors is strictly prohibited and will result in immediate account termination and reporting to relevant authorities.
Whistly is not directed at children under 16 years of age. During onboarding, all users must confirm they are at least 16 years old before they can use the app. We do not knowingly allow users under 16 to create accounts or post content.

SoftSignal Canada complies with all relevant child safety laws including but not limited to Canada's Criminal Code provisions on child exploitation, the Protecting Canadians from Online Crime Act, and applicable international frameworks for child protection online.
